all the metal t bars are the same, it doesnt matter which you use, I only mention snake eyes and hawk kuz I hate them both!, seperating figures in general is dicey at times, I have found that the best way to seperate the lowers is to use a large handled razor knife, stanley makes a good one , just slide it into the crack where the two halves meet and when you hear the magig "pop" twist a little and there you go.
